Output 59de32303dbddf112cfc1426ca33795595ac95dc3283b510959155954e66b736:45
- value
- 20296
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d34de877216c4c773741b78fb8b070f08fddbc1
- address
- bc1ql56dapmjzmzvwum5rdu0hzc8puy0mk7p2a3znn
- transaction
- 59de32303dbddf112cfc1426ca33795595ac95dc3283b510959155954e66b736